My Wishlist

  ProductPriceQuantityStock statusAdded Date 
× SBL Staphysagria SBL Staphysagria
100 in stockOctober 23, 2025
× SBL Staphysagria 1X Q SBL Staphysagria 1X Q 382.50425.00
100 in stockOctober 23, 2025 Add to cart

Main Menu